#594781 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#594781 is composed of 34.9% red, 27.8% green and 50.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 31% cyan, 45% magenta, 0% yellow and 49.4% black. It has a hue angle of 258.6 degrees, a saturation of 29% and a lightness of 39.2%. #594781 color hex could be obtained by blending #b28eff with #000003.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

Shades and Tints of #594781
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020102 is the darkest color, while #f6f5f9 is the lightest one.
